Section 1: Hemodialysis Principles & Physics (Q1-20)


Question 1
The process by which solutes move across a semipermeable membrane from an area
of higher concentration to lower concentration is called:
A. Ultrafiltration
B. Diffusion
C. Osmosis


D. Convection


B. Diffusion [CORRECT]


Rationale: Diffusion is the movement of solutes down a concentration gradient across a
semipermeable membrane. Ultrafiltration is fluid movement by pressure gradient.
Osmosis is water movement down a concentration gradient. Convection is solute
transport by solvent drag during ultrafiltration.


Correct Answer: B


Question 2
Which factor most directly increases the rate of solute clearance during hemodialysis?
A. Decreasing the dialysate flow rate
B. Increasing the blood flow rate
C. Using a smaller surface area dialyzer

,D. Decreasing the transmembrane pressure


B. Increasing the blood flow rate [CORRECT]


Rationale: Increasing blood flow rate (Qb) enhances the concentration gradient between
blood and dialysate, maximizing diffusive clearance. Decreasing dialysate flow, using
smaller dialyzers, or decreasing TMP all reduce clearance efficiency. Blood flow rate is
the most significant modifiable factor affecting urea clearance.


Correct Answer: B


Question 3
A patient receives dialysis with a blood flow rate of 400 mL/min and dialysate flow rate
of 800 mL/min. The dialyzer KoA is 1200 mL/min. Which statement about clearance is
most accurate?
A. Clearance is limited primarily by the dialyzer KoA
B. Clearance is limited primarily by the blood flow rate
C. Clearance is limited primarily by the dialysate flow rate


D. Clearance is unlimited because all values are high


B. Clearance is limited primarily by the blood flow rate [CORRECT]


Rationale: When blood flow rate (400 mL/min) is substantially lower than dialysate flow
rate (800 mL/min) and KoA (1200 mL/min), clearance is primarily limited by the blood
flow rate. The relationship follows that clearance cannot exceed approximately 80-90%
of the lowest flow-limiting factor, which in this case is Qb.


Correct Answer: B

,Question 4
Ultrafiltration during hemodialysis is driven primarily by which force?
A. Oncotic pressure across the dialyzer membrane
B. Hydrostatic pressure gradient (transmembrane pressure)
C. Osmotic pressure of the dialysate


D. Electrostatic attraction between solutes


B. Hydrostatic pressure gradient (transmembrane pressure) [CORRECT]


Rationale: Ultrafiltration is the movement of plasma water across the dialyzer
membrane driven by the hydrostatic pressure gradient between the blood compartment
and dialysate compartment, known as transmembrane pressure (TMP). Oncotic
pressure opposes ultrafiltration. Osmotic pressure is not the primary driver in standard
hemodialysis.


Correct Answer: B


Question 5
Which dialyzer membrane characteristic is most important for removing middle
molecules such as beta-2 microglobulin?
A. Small pore size with high sieving coefficient for urea
B. Large pore size with high hydraulic permeability
C. Low biocompatibility with complement activation


D. Small surface area with low KoA


B. Large pore size with high hydraulic permeability [CORRECT]


Rationale: Middle molecules (500-5000 Daltons, e.g., beta-2 microglobulin) require
dialyzers with larger pore sizes and higher hydraulic permeability (high-flux membranes)

, for effective removal. Small-pore low-flux membranes primarily clear small solutes like
urea. Biocompatibility and surface area are important but do not directly determine
middle molecule clearance.


Correct Answer: B


Question 6
A patient has a pre-dialysis BUN of 84 mg/dL and post-dialysis BUN of 28 mg/dL. The
URR is calculated as:
A. 33%
B. 50%
C. 66%


D. 75%


C. 66% [CORRECT]


Rationale: Urea reduction ratio (URR) = [(Pre-BUN - Post-BUN) / Pre-BUN] × 100.
Calculation: [(84 - 28) / 84] × 100 = () × 100 = 66.7%, rounded to 66%. URR is a
simplified measure of dialysis adequacy with a minimum target of 65% per KDOQI
guidelines.


Correct Answer: C
